Description
There is a snail on the ground. This snail will climb a wooden stick that is V meters high.
The snail can climb A meters during the day. However, it slides B meters while sleeping at night. Also, it does not slide once it reaches the top.
Write a program to calculate how many days it takes for the snail to climb the entire wooden stick.
Input
The first line contains the number of test cases, t, as an integer. (1 ≤ t ≤ 10)
The following t lines contain three integers A, B, and V separated by spaces. (1 ≤ B < A ≤ V ≤ 1,000,000,000)
Output
For each test case, output the number of days it takes for the snail to climb all the wooden sticks, one per line.
3
2 1 5
5 1 6
100 99 1000000000
